Ohio-based metal quintet Alteras released their new album Grief on August 5th. The full-length marks the band’s label debut with Revival Recordings (owned by Shawn Milke of Alesana) and harnesses the band’s technically proficient sound, throat-ripping screams, and melodic pop-sensibility. Youngstown, OH quintet Alteras has recently inked a deal with Revival Recordings (owned by Shawn Milke of Alesana). The band will make their label debut with the new full-length Grief, out on August 5th.
